Cogent Communications Holdings, Inc. Q4 2025 Earnings Call Summary
Yahoo Finance· 2026-02-20 17:32
Core Insights - The company has successfully completed the integration of Sprint and Cogent networks, shifting its focus from restructuring to organic growth and product optimization [1] Performance Overview - The performance is driven by a strategic shift towards high-margin on-net products, which now account for 61% of total revenue, up from 47% in 2023 [1] - There has been a 64% decline in acquired Sprint wireline revenue since the closing, which has overshadowed a 27% growth in the legacy Cogent Classic business during the same period [1] Growth Drivers - Wavelength services are becoming a key growth driver, with revenue increasing by 74% year-over-year as the company capitalizes on the largest North American footprint [1] - IPv4 leasing continues to be a high-margin contributor, with revenue growing 44% year-over-year as the company monetizes its unused address space through wholesale and retail channels [1] Financial Metrics - EBITDA margin is expected to expand by nearly 800 basis points in 2025, driven by significant cost savings and the removal of low-margin non-core Sprint products [1]
